W. Schwarz is a scholar working on Molecular Biology, Cell Biology and Physiology. According to data from OpenAlex, W. Schwarz has authored 49 papers receiving a total of 750 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 8 papers in Cell Biology and 6 papers in Physiology. Recurrent topics in W. Schwarz's work include Mitochondrial Function and Pathology (3 papers), Electrochemical Analysis and Applications (3 papers) and Various Chemistry Research Topics (3 papers). W. Schwarz is often cited by papers focused on Mitochondrial Function and Pathology (3 papers), Electrochemical Analysis and Applications (3 papers) and Various Chemistry Research Topics (3 papers). W. Schwarz collaborates with scholars based in Germany, Netherlands and Colombia. W. Schwarz's co-authors include Irving. Shain, H. J. Merker, G. K. Suchowsky, F.-H. Güldner, J. S. Chang, Daniel W. Brown, J. Pacansky, Gudrun Pahlke, Edward M. Kosower and D. Graf Keyserlingk and has published in prestigious journals such as Journal of the American Chemical Society, SHILAP Revista de lepidopterología and The Journal of Physical Chemistry.
